We’ve Got a Bleeder!

The adventure continues!  Just found out I’ve got internal bleeding 🙂  My team and I are hoping we can BIOTP, (Blame It On The Prednisone) and not something more serious.  To rule out the more serious, I had CT scans of my chest, abdomen and pelvis.  The procedure was not a big deal.  I just felt like I was on fire from the inside out.  Thankfully, the results came back normal, and I am now looking forward to a colonoscopy and an upper endoscopy to try to find the source of the bleeding.  Of course, because IHNFP (I Have No F-ing Platelets), I will have platelet transfusion #8 immediately preceding these fun-filled procedures.

Being that I’ve been on Prednisone for over a month now, I can really start to see the famous side effects kicking in.  I have FUSUOLS (F-ed Up Super Ugly Old Lady Skin) big time!  It also appears I am storing acorns in my cheeks that will last me the fall and winter.  It is probably/hopefully the cause of my internal bleeding, since it is often associated with small tears in the stomach and/or intestines.  It’s true – PAB (Prednisone’s A Bitch).  Prednisone is not my only med, however.  I am taking a multitude of pills throughout the day to try to keep my blood levels where they should be, and my team is planning on adding more soon.
